You can easily extract any of the printed text in the Aneros Forums to be 'read' to you via text to voice conversion software. There are numerous companies which make such software. NaturalSoft© is but one such company and they even offer a free version available for download that will work for you.
Though the coversion does not flow as smoothly as natural speech, it is sufficiently coherent to understand most of what is written and being spoken. I believe this would satisfy your request.
